Structure and Production of Casomorphins,) are the most abundant group of exorphins released from the β-casein of human and bovine milk. Casomorphins differ from each other on the source of milk (bovine/human) and the number and sequence of amino acids. The commonly studied casomorphins include bovine BCM-4, 5, 6, 7, 8 and neocasomorphin-6作者: 高歌 時(shí)間: 2025-3-26 00:08
